452 * Check if we have already initialized to use this terminal. If so, we
453 * do not need to re-read the terminfo entry, or obtain TTY settings.
455 * This is an improvement on SVr4 curses. If an application mixes curses
456 * and termcap calls, it may call both initscr and tgetent. This is not
457 * really a good thing to do, but can happen if someone tries using ncurses
458 * with the readline library. The problem we are fixing is that when
459 * tgetent calls setupterm, the resulting Ottyb struct in cur_term is
460 * zeroed. A subsequent call to endwin uses the zeroed terminal settings
461 * rather than the ones saved in initscr. So we check if cur_term appears
462 * to contain terminal settings for the same output file as our current
463 * call - and copy those terminal settings. (SVr4 curses does not do this,
464 * however applications that are working around the problem will still work
465 * properly with this feature).
